**Mgmt Meeting Minutes — Retiring the Brightline Range**

Quick recap for sales leads at Fenholt Supplies: we agreed to retire the Brightline fixture range by year-end. Remaining stock moves to clearance pricing next month, and accounts on standing orders get migrated to the Lumetta range. Trade-in incentives were approved in principle. The confidential note on next steps sits just below.

board note of bajof-bajeg: The pricing group signed off on a budget of $13.4 million for Project Sildor. The renewal with Lamixek Holdings closes at $48.9 million a year, 49 percent above the last contract.

## Step 4: Enable bulk edits in the admin table

After migrating Lanternfell to schema v9, bulk edits in the Registry Admin table are gated behind a new permission flag. Review the audit trail settings before enabling: every bulk operation is logged with actor, row count, and diff hash, and the retention window must match your compliance baseline. Rate limits on bulk mutations are enforced server-side and cannot be overridden per-session. The values currently applied to the staging environment are listed below.

settings of tagef-bawif:
DRUIX_HOST=druix.zemvarlabs.internal
DRUIX_PORT=8000

**CI note: ORM refactor fallout.** The Marrowbase legacy ORM refactor (branch `orm-untangle`) keeps failing the integration stage because fixture loading now runs before schema migration. If you see `relation missing` errors in the Pellworth pipeline, rerun the job with the migration-first flag enabled — it's a known ordering bug, not your change. Don't restart the whole pipeline; that wipes the cache and adds twenty minutes. The failing runs all trace back to the build stamped below.

build token for yajof-bajof: htk31_506ff1188f74596b5bb2eec94edc43c

## Configuration

The Chipline reader daemon is what turns mat pings into actual finish times, so let's get it set up right. Copy `env.sample` to `.env` on the timing laptop before race morning — seriously, not at the start line. Set `CL_MAT_COUNT` to the number of mats and `CL_EVENT_SLUG` to the race code from the Racewrangle dashboard. The daemon also needs its upload credential to push splits to Racewrangle, which goes on the next line:

vault entry, kagep-yajeg: COURIER_KEY5=da097